Anxiety is a disorder that may negatively impact the quality of life for people with hypertension. In Marrakech, epidemiological data on anxiety in hypertension patients are scarce, preventing holistic treatment hypertensive and favoring development comorbidities. This study aims to assess prevalence self-reported among receiving care primary healthcare centers Marrakech. Between May 2021 December 2022, cross-sectional 1053 who visited Marrakech was carried out. Socio-demographic information, behavioral clinical characteristics, care-patient-physician triad were all collected via face-to-face questionnaire. The Generalized Disorder Scale (GAD-7) used anxiety. Multivariate logistic regression identify risk factors A total 348 (33.1%) those overall reported having symptoms. 301 (86.5%) females, mean age 61.5 ± 9.6 years (mean standard deviation). High stress, moderate family history hypertension, pain physical discomfort, non-purchase drug if it out stock at centers, living urban areas, lack social support, non-consumption five fruits vegetables per day identified as Self-reported prevalent one third Hence, greater emphasis should be placed mental health component when managing centers.

Background The life satisfaction (LS) of individuals among older adults with diabetes should not be neglected. However, current research provides limited insight into the LS in China. Therefore, primary objective this study is to assess status China, delve factors influencing it, and identify key factors. Methods This selected 1,304 patients from Chinese Longitudinal Healthy Longevity Survey (CLHLS) database for analysis. A multivariate logistic regression model was used analyze diabetic patients, a random forest further utilized rank importance significant Results 30.14% were dissatisfied their lives. Multivariate Logistic analysis shows that self-assessed health status, economic depressive symptoms, exercise, living arrangements, hearing impairment, cognitive impairment all significantly affect diabetics. OR values are relatively high, fair poor 5.03 times 9.72 higher risk dissatisfaction compared those good (fair: = 5.03, 95% CI: 3.46–7.31; poor: 9.72, 6.20–15.26). feeling 7.69 than (OR 7.69, 95%CI: 4.25–13.89). results showed order highest lowest impairment. Conclusion Our reveals rate high. it essential implement measures multiple perspectives effective prevention intervention. Among these factors, priority given interventions focusing on support management, as may serve crucial protective enhancing well-being diabetes.
